On May 3, a regular workshop within the framework of the project “REGION: National Network for Reliable Information on Electoral Processes” was held in the Kapan community of the Syunik region, bringing together first-time voters.

Led by project trainer Mariam Mkrtchyan, the participants discussed the role of citizens and the importance of participation in a democratic society, the fundamental principles of electoral rights, as well as election day procedures and tools for preventing electoral violations. During the second half of the workshop, through a simulation game, participants practically experienced the entire cycle of election day, from polling station setup to the final tabulation of results.

The workshop is implemented with the financial support of the European Union and the German Marshall Fund of the United States-Transatlantic Foundation (GMF TF).
